Output 50c725c797027c958a17cda3a09b49785cfa8ce747374bda46e08e0103f09d43:0

value
3382600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71ab7f440dc8757540bbd50a2e625435fe30d9c8 OP_EQUAL
address
3C43j3sEhANZGsb5BiZ29sGMp6PNMvWaEP
transaction
50c725c797027c958a17cda3a09b49785cfa8ce747374bda46e08e0103f09d43
confirmations
433202
spent
true